Ошибка "Unhandled Runtime Error TypeError: Cannot read properties of undefined (reading 'default')" возникает, когда в вашем коде вы пытаетесь получить доступ к свойству "default" у неопределенного значения. Эта ошибка часто возникает в React-приложениях, особенно при использовании библиотеки Next.js.
Эта ошибка обычно связана с импортом некорректных модулей или несовпадением их версий. Вот несколько возможных решений для исправления этой ошибки:
1. Убедитесь, что у вас установлена соответствующая версия зависимостей React и Next.js, и эти версии совместимы. Версии обычно указываются в файле package.json вашего проекта. Если есть несовместимости, вам нужно обновить версии или перейти на совместимые.
2. Проверьте, правильно ли вы импортируете необходимые модули. Проверьте синтаксис и путь к модулю, который вы пытаетесь импортировать. Проверьте также, правильно ли вы используете оператор "default" при импорте модулей.
3. Рассматривайте следующий пример:
import React from 'react';
Проверьте, что в вашем коде используется правильный импорт библиотеки React. Проверьте также, что React установлен в вашем проекте и версия React совместима с версией Next.js, которую вы используете.
4. Если у вас используются дополнительные пакеты или сторонние модули, проверьте, что они также установлены и импортированы правильно. Убедитесь, что у вас установлена последняя версия каждого пакета и они совместимы с вашей версией React и Next.js.
5. Если приведенные выше решения не помогли, попробуйте переустановить зависимости вашего проекта и запустить проект с чистым кешем. Выполните следующие команды в терминале:
npm cache clean --force npm install
6. Проверьте, что у вас нет опечаток или синтаксических ошибок в вашем коде. Проверьте каждую строку кода, связанную с импортами и вызовами компонентов.
Если ни одно из вышеперечисленных решений не помогло исправить ошибку, может быть полезно привести код, на котором возникает ошибка, чтобы другие разработчики могли помочь вам с поиском более конкретного решения.